cover image
NTT DATA North America

NTT DATA North America

us.nttdata.com

4 Jobs

26,137 Employees

About the Company

NTT DATA, Inc. is a trusted global innovator of business and technology services. We're committed to helping clients innovate, optimize and transform for long-term success. Our R&D investments help organizations and society move confidently and sustainably into the digital future. As a Global Top Employer, we have diverse experts in more than 50 countries and a robust partner ecosystem of established and start-up companies. Our services include business and technology consulting, data and artificial intelligence, industry solutions, as well as the development, implementation and management of applications, infrastructure, and connectivity.

Listed Jobs

Company background Company brand
Company Name
NTT DATA North America
Job Title
UI Angular Front End Developer (Montreal onsite hybrid)
Job Description
Job title: UI Angular Front End Developer Role Summary: Design, develop and maintain responsive Angular/UHTML/CSS interfaces, consuming RESTful services and integrating with relational databases. Mentor junior developers, provide technical direction, and contribute to architectural and design discussions. Expectations: • Lead technically on user‑interface projects. • Identify root causes of problems, assess business impact, and devise solutions. • Prioritize and manage multiple milestones and deliverables efficiently. • Support system design, specification development, and flow‑charting for project objectives. Key Responsibilities: - Develop clean, performant front‑end code using Angular/AngularJS, TypeScript, JavaScript, HTML5, CSS3, jQuery, and AJAX. - Build responsive, UX‑driven UI components for web and mobile applications. - Consume and design RESTful APIs; coordinate with back‑end services. - Write and maintain SQL queries and stored procedures for Oracle or SQL Server databases. - Perform unit, integration, and UI tests; manage version control with Git. - Conduct code reviews, document technical decisions, and contribute to design‑review meetings. - Mentor junior developers on coding standards, debugging, and architectural patterns. - Utilize development tools (Eclipse, Maven, ANT, Nexus, JBoss, SOAP UI) to deliver robust builds. Required Skills: - 3+ years’ experience with Angular/AngularJS and modern front‑end technologies. - Strong command of HTML, CSS, TypeScript, JavaScript, jQuery, AJAX, and responsive design. - Proficiency in relational databases (Oracle or SQL Server), SQL, and stored procedures. - Experience designing and implementing RESTful APIs. - Familiarity with development tools: Eclipse, Git, Nexus, Maven, ANT, JBoss App Server, SOAP UI. - Ability to lead junior staff, solve complex problems, and manage multiple projects. - Solid understanding of UI/UX principles and mobile‑first design. Required Education & Certifications: - Bachelor’s degree in Computer Science, Software Engineering, or related field. - Relevant certifications in Angular, JavaScript frameworks, or front‑end development preferred.
Montreal, Canada
On site
Junior
30-10-2025
Company background Company brand
Company Name
NTT DATA North America
Job Title
FullStack Java/Angular Engineer - On-Site
Job Description
**Job Title:** FullStack Java/Angular Engineer **Role Summary:** Lead end‑to‑end development of enterprise web and middle‑tier applications using Angular, TypeScript, and Java (Spring/Spring Boot). Design, implement, and maintain scalable solutions within a high‑impact squad focused on platform modernization. **Expectations:** - Deliver high‑quality, production‑ready code in an Agile Scrum environment. - Own component deliverables while collaborating effectively with cross‑functional teams. - Mentor peers, share knowledge, and foster a culture of continuous improvement. **Key Responsibilities:** - Design, code, test, and deploy full‑stack features in Angular/Java environments. - Create and consume REST/GraphQL, JSON, XML, SOAP services. - Build containerized applications (Docker) and orchestrate with Kubernetes, Terraform, and AWS. - Configure CI/CD pipelines using Jenkins (or equivalent) and automate tests (JUnit, Karma, Jasmine, Cucumber, Selenium, Serenity). - Manage source control with GitHub, including pull requests and code reviews. - Utilize generative AI tools (GitHub Copilot) to enhance productivity. - Participate in sprint planning, daily stand‑ups, retrospectives, and backlog refinement. **Required Skills:** - 5+ years of full‑stack development (Angular, TypeScript, Java, Spring/Spring Boot). - Proficiency with API/Web services (JSON, XML, REST, SOAP). - Experience with Docker, Kubernetes, Terraform, AWS cloud deployments. - Strong unit‑testing and automation experience (JUnit, Karma, Jasmine, Cucumber, Selenium, Serenity). - CI/CD pipeline configuration and automated deployment. - Git/GitHub expertise (pull requests, branching strategies). - Familiarity with AI coding assistants (GitHub Copilot). - Excellent problem‑solving, communication, and leadership skills. **Required Education & Certifications:** - B.S. in Computer Science, Engineering, Mathematics, or equivalent professional experience.
Halifax, Canada
On site
Mid level
29-10-2025
Company background Company brand
Company Name
NTT DATA North America
Job Title
Salesforce DevOps Engineer
Job Description
**Job Title** Salesforce DevOps Engineer **Role Summary** Design, implement, and maintain CI/CD pipelines and automation for the Salesforce platform using GitHub Actions and related tools. Ensure smooth, repeatable deployments across sandbox, scratch, and production environments while enforcing quality, security, and governance standards. **Expectations** - Deliver reliable, automated deployment processes that reduce manual effort and accelerate release cycles. - Collaborate with developers, admins, and business analysts to integrate changes seamlessly. - Continuously improve system reliability through proactive monitoring, troubleshooting, and documentation. **Key Responsibilities** - Build and optimize CI/CD pipelines in GitHub Actions for Salesforce deployments. - Automate deployments across multiple Salesforce environments (sandboxes, scratch orgs, production). - Manage source control strategy, including branching, merging, and version control best practices. - Implement static code analysis and automated tests (e.g., PMD, Apex tests) within pipelines. - Ensure compliance with security, data, and governance standards. - Monitor workflow logs, troubleshoot build/deployment issues, and refine processes for efficiency. - Provide documentation and training on DevOps best practices for Salesforce teams. **Required Skills** - Proven experience as a Salesforce DevOps Engineer or Release Engineer. - Strong knowledge of the Salesforce development lifecycle, metadata, and packaging. - Expertise with GitHub Actions, Git, and version control workflows. - Hands‑on experience with Salesforce CLI (sfdx), scratch orgs, and automation scripts. - Familiarity with static code analysis tools (PMD) and Apex testing frameworks. - Excellent problem‑solving, troubleshooting, and communication skills. **Required Education & Certifications** - Bachelor’s degree in Computer Science, Information Technology, or related field (or equivalent experience). - Salesforce Platform Developer I and/or Developer II certifications are required; Salesforce Certified DevOps Engineer certification is highly preferred.
Sheffield, United kingdom
On site
07-01-2026
Company background Company brand
Company Name
NTT DATA North America
Job Title
Salesforce Developer
Job Description
**Job Title:** Salesforce Developer **Role Summary:** Develop, customize, and optimize Salesforce applications using Apex, Visualforce, Lightning Components, Lightning Web Components, and Flows. Lead design and implementation of new features, integrations, and Experience Cloud solutions, ensuring adherence to enterprise patterns and best practices. **Expectations:** - Deliver high‑quality, scalable code within project timelines. - Mentor peers and perform code reviews. - Maintain comprehensive technical documentation. - Continuously improve development processes and encourage best practices. **Key Responsibilities:** - Design, develop, test, and deploy Salesforce functionalities to meet business requirements. - Build and customize standard and custom components on the Salesforce platform. - Implement solutions with Apex, Visualforce, Lightning Components, Lightning Web Components, and Flows. - Apply enterprise design patterns and optimize performance within governor limits. - Integrate Salesforce with external systems using SOAP, REST, Streaming (Lightning Events), and Metadata APIs. - Refine and articulate technical user stories and solutions. - Author Technical Design Documents in collaboration with Tech Leads. - Suggest and implement workflow improvements for the development team. **Required Skills:** - Proven experience in Salesforce development (several years). - Strong expertise in Salesforce Experience Cloud. - Proficiency in Apex, Visualforce, Lightning Components, Lightning Web Components, and Flow. - Deep understanding of governor limits and performance optimization. - Advanced skills in SOAP, REST, Streaming, and Metadata API integrations. - Excellent technical documentation and communication abilities. - Experience with agile and waterfall methodologies (preferred). **Required Education & Certifications:** - Salesforce Platform Developer II certification (mandatory). - Bachelor’s degree in Computer Science, Information Systems, or related field (preferred).
Sheffield, United kingdom
On site
07-01-2026